Complex Material: Unique Properties and Repair Challenges
Carbon fiber, a material renowned for its exceptional strength-to-weight ratio and durability, presents unique challenges for every carbon fiber repair expert. Its intricate structure, characterized by woven layers of high-performance fibers imbedded in a matrix, demands specialized knowledge and skills to mend effectively. Unlike traditional metal or composite materials, carbon fiber’s inherent flexibility and the interlayer bonding properties make it sensitive to heat and pressure during repair processes.
For the carbon fiber repair expert, this translates into careful consideration when addressing dents, cracks, or other damage. Techniques such as heat management, specialized adhesives, and precise tooling become crucial for restoring the material’s structural integrity without compromising its unique properties. Specialized Tools: Acquisition and Proficiency Requirements
Carbon fiber repair experts require a specialized set of tools tailored to the unique properties of this advanced material. While traditional metal repair techniques often employ simple hammers, torches, and welding machines, carbon fiber repairs demand more intricate and precise instruments. These include specialized knives for cutting and shaping, vacuum bag systems to ensure proper resin infusion during the repair process, and precision sensors to measure and monitor temperature and pressure.
Acquiring this equipment is only the first step; proficiency in using them is equally vital. Carbon fiber repair experts must undergo extensive training to master these tools, understanding their functions and limitations intimately. Invisible Repairs: Achieving Unnoticeable Results for Carbon Fiber Components
For carbon fiber repair experts, invisible repairs are an art and a science. The goal is to achieve unnoticeable results, restoring the component to its original state while blending seamlessly with the rest of the vehicle’s structure. This requires meticulous attention to detail, as even the slightest imperfection can be magnified by the eye. Carbon fiber’s unique texture and transparency demand precision techniques, such as matching the weave pattern precisely and using specialized adhesives that bond securely without leaving traces.
These invisible repairs are not just about aesthetics; they’re crucial for structural integrity. A carbon fiber component, whether in a Mercedes Benz collision repair or an auto body repair job, must be restored to its original strength and stability. Carbon fiber repair experts employ advanced tools and techniques, such as micro-sanding and clear coat restoration, to ensure the repaired area is both invisible and strong.
